BRONXVILLE, N.Y. – The Sarah Lawrence women's swimming team opened its 2019-20 campaign Saturday with victories over Queensborough CC (87-18) and St. Joseph's Brooklyn (89-50) at Campbell Sports Center.
IN SHORT
Sarah Lawrence (1-0) def. Queensborough CC (0-2), 87-18
Sarah Lawrence (2-0, 1-0) def. St. Joseph's Brooklyn (1-2, 0-1), 89-50
INDIVIDUAL WINNERS
Audrey de Szendeffy was victorious in the 200 free, touching the wall in 2:17.95, nearly 20 seconds faster than the second-place participant.
Lillian Eaton made her collegiate debut, finishing as the top swimmer in the 50 free with a mark of 33.12.
Katherine McKane swam in her first meet at Sarah Lawrence Saturday, earning first-place in the 200 IM with a time of a 2:26.88. The rookie was also victorious in the 100 back, recording a swim of 1:09.36.
Drew Lei-Alerta swam in the 100 fly, touching the wall in 1:04.23. The sophomore also competed in the 500 free, finishing in 5:45.14.
Frankie Iannuzzi had a strong showing in her collegiate debut, winning the 100 breast with a time of 1:27.04.
RELAYS
Sarah Lawrence was the top team in the 200 free relay, as a quartet comprised of McKane, de Szendeffy, Iannuzzi and Lei-Alerta finished the race in 1:57.92.
